Kevinmikegrit wrote:I just opened an account, but am clueless on how to invest as my credit cards cannot be accessed maybe due to the ban by CBSL, any idea guys on how to move things forward?
P. S. - I will be investing very small amounts just to get a hang of it may be around 2 - 2.5% of my investments

Yes firstly, you can't just add a card and deposit money in the ordinary way as CBSL blocked all payment gateways for crypto. So we have to use Peer to Peer option. There's a option called P2P in Binance. Which is another person sells money for some higher rate. But sometimes fees are 0% or 1% when using bank transfer. There are so many options such as direct bank transfer, PayPal, Skrill, Neteller, Adcash  and much more.

roshan1039


Moderator
Moderator

Forums are there to debate and share ideas, someone can tell this is good that is good. Others will have different ideas.
If we share our views only someone can understand, otherwise just because we dont like to take that risk we cannot keep our mouth shut.
I have experienced crypto well, because of my experiences i dont recommend it.
Thats my view, there are number of reasons for that:
You dont have any responsible organization taking accountability of your money, if it is stolen its gone.
It is banned in sri lanka.
There are ways to deposit money but with lot of transaction costs and risks.
Then these are very sensitive to mkt news, if u invest u have to be very alert otherwise following u lost 100%
There is a posibility some accounts get blocked and you wont be able to secure it back.
If someone thinking of investing in crypto u have to master the trading and the platform you are going to use.
Remember you must be a master of trading.
If not forget crypto is my recommendation.
